What a dissapointment. I had been looking forward to going here for a while, however, when I eventually went for breakfast last week I was bitterly dissapointed.
Decor was pleasant, service was ok, not brilliant but certainly not bad either. I opted for the eggs benedict, my friend had the eggs royale. It come with bread to toast yourself in the provided toaster. This was all very well but the toaster took about 15 minutes to toast the bread. When the food come, my eggs benedict was at best luke warm! Now I hate to sound snobbish, but when I am paying £25-£30 for breakfast, I am sorry but I don’t expect to find 4 stonking big thumb prints around my plate. Maybe down the local cafe but not in a supposedly 'fine dining’ establishment. I would bet any money that this place will be gone inside 2 years. A typical example of all style and no substance. I have had better breakfasts for less than a tenner, in fact maybe even less than a fiver!
